2013 年 5 月の履歴(もしくは日誌)


2013 年 5 月

5 月 23 日

Google ロケーション履歴から GPX トラックログへの変換

Google はユーザの位置情報を記録していて,それはGoogle ロケーション履歴で確認できます.もちろん位置情報の記録を許可した場合だけです.でも iPhone なんかで Google を使っていれば,しらない間にGoogle ロケーション履歴に記録が残っていたなんて事も.これをどう活用するか.例えばこの位置情報を使って,写真に位置情報を付加できると良いですよね.たとえば Latipics っていう Mac のアプリケーションソフトウェアは,まさに Google ロケーション履歴のデータを使って,写真データに位置情報を付加します.Android の Latify もそういうアプリらしいです.

Google ロケーション履歴からは KML ファイルがダウンロードできます.これを使って写真に位置情報を付けられれば良いのですが,これってそういうアプリで使えない場合も多いみたい.Garmib BaseCamp では Googleロケーション履歴の KML ファイルを GPX Track log に変換できました.やっぱり GPX Track log のほうがいろいろ使えて便利です.この手の変換の GPSBabel でうまく変換できないので,変換方法で困る人は多いみたい.

以前ぼくは Google Latitude のデータ,つまり Google ロケーション履歴の KML ファイルを GPX Track log に変換する Perl スクリプトを書いて公開していたんだけど,Google Latitude の KML ファイルの書式が変更されて動かなくなってしまっていました.

ところが今日は,Perl スクリプト動かないよ!ってメールが届きました.英語でメールが来たので英語で動かない理由を説明したメールを返信したのですが,そんな英文を書くくらいなら Perl スクリプトを書き直したほうが早かったなぁと.

そういうわけで,書き直しました.

github で公開してくれってそのメールではリクエストされていたので,気が向いたら試してみるかな github

http://onohiroki.cycling.jp/tb/tb.cgi/weblog_d20130523n1 TrackBack

更新情報